The Evolution Of SD Card Capacity: From Megabytes To Terabytes

The storage capacity of SD cards has come a long way since their introduction in 1999. Initially, SD cards had a mere capacity of a few megabytes, which was sufficient for storing text documents and images. However, with the advancement in technology, the need for higher storage capacities became evident.

Over the years, SD card capacity has continued to increase, reaching remarkable milestones. The industry-standard SDHC (Secure Digital High Capacity) cards offered storage capacities up to 32 gigabytes (GB), followed by the SDXC (Secure Digital Extended Capacity) cards that supported up to 2 terabytes (TB). Alternative Solutions: Beyond SD Cards – Other Options For High-capacity Storage

As technology continues to advance at a rapid rate, the demand for high-capacity storage solutions is also on the rise. While SD cards have been the go-to option for portable data storage, there are alternative solutions available that offer even greater storage capacity.

One such alternative is solid-state drives (SSDs), which are commonly used in computers and laptops. SSDs utilize flash memory technology, similar to SD cards, but they typically offer much larger capacities. With SSDs, it is not uncommon to find options with multiple terabytes of storage space. These drives are not as portable as SD cards, but they provide a reliable and efficient option for large-scale data storage.

Another alternative is cloud storage. With the increasing popularity of cloud-based services, storing data remotely has become a viable option. Cloud storage providers offer plans with terabytes of storage space, allowing users to upload and access their files from anywhere with an internet connection.

In addition, external hard drives and network attached storage (NAS) devices are also alternative options for high-capacity storage. These devices typically offer larger capacities than SD cards and provide the flexibility to connect to multiple devices for easy data sharing.

While SD cards have their advantages, exploring alternative solutions can provide users with even greater storage capacity and flexibility for their data storage needs.
